[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: [Nmh-workers] Only outputting "valid" characters
From: |
Ken Hornstein |
Subject: |
Re: [Nmh-workers] Only outputting "valid" characters |
Date: |
Sat, 12 Jul 2014 09:39:55 -0400 |
> If s is not a null pointer, mbtowc() shall either return 0 (if s
> points to the null byte), or return the number of bytes that
> constitute the converted character (if the next n or fewer bytes
> form a valid character), or return -1 and may set errno to indicate
> the error (if they do not form a valid character).
>
>It goes on to mention EILSEQ. Does that cover your case?
It ... might? I always find a rather large gap between theory and reality
when it comes to those wide character POSIX functions. I think I'll have
to write some tests.
--Ken